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Leverkusen, Germany and Italy?

ITA Airways, Lufthansa, and three other airlines fly from Düsseldorf International Airport (DUS) to Milan Linate Airport (LIN) every 3 hours. Alternatively, you can take a train from Leverkusen Mitte to Roma Termini via Koeln Messe/Deutz, Köln Messe/Deutz Bf, Mannheim, Hauptbahnhof, Basel SBB, Lugano, and Milano Centrale in around 14h 35m.
